Dog rescue in Toledo, OH

Toledo's PET Bull Project rescues dogs and puppies from our local community. Our mission is to Prevent animal cruelty and dog fighting in our community; to Educate on the importance of spay & neuter; and to Train people to be good advocates for their pet, whatever their breed.

Once you submit your application, it will be reviewed; vet and landlord checks, if applicable, will be done. If everything checks out, the application will be sent to the foster. The foster will then review it and will contact you to discuss said application.

Alliance for Contraception in Cats and Dogs

There is a tremendous need for new methods of sterilization that are faster, easier, more accessible, and less expensive than surgery. ACC&D works tirelessly to bring together key stakeholders to advance this field.
